Overview

This program is designed to highlight the latest developments in the multidisciplinary management of bladder and kidney cancers. The aim of the course is provide attendees with information that will aid in the delivery of state-of-the-art care to patients with all stages of bladder and kidney cancers. Highlights of this year’s program include:

— Management strategies for localized kidney cancer and non-muscle invasive bladder cancer

— Neoadjuvant and adjuvant systemic therapies for muscle-invasive bladder cancer

— Treatment paradigms for advanced kidney cancer and optimal surgical approaches for high-risk cases

— Advanced imaging modalities for kidney cancer

— The role of intraoperative and SBRT techniques for treating bladder and kidney cancers

— A review of hereditary kidney cancer syndromes

The keynote presentation will detail the new standards in managing advanced urothelial cancer. Updated trial data will be presented, detailing recent changes in the standard of care for advanced urothelial cancer, focusing on combination therapies that include novel antibody-drug conjugates and checkpoint inhibitors. Additionally, the program will include video sessions that highlight surgical techniques for urinary diversion, utilizing both open and robotic methods, as well as radical nephrectomy with thrombectomy.

This course is intended for urologists, urologic-oncologists, medical oncologists, radiation oncologists, pathologists, radiologists, nurses, and other healthcare professionals.

Objectives
At the conclusion of this program, attendees will be able to:
  1. Present a multidisciplinary approach to the management of bladder and kidney cancer including surgical, medical, and radiation therapies
  2. Disseminate knowledge of new approaches to the multidisciplinary management of bladder and kidney cancer
  3. Integrate new therapeutics into the treatment of localized, locally advanced, and metastatic bladder and kidney cancers
